What is Postal ID?

Get your Postal ID, and a government-issued card by PHLPost. It’s the quickest and easiest ID to get in the Philippines.

Step By Step Guide: How to apply for Postal ID Online Appointment

Step 1:

Fill out the application forms with your details. Take them, along with your requirements and payment, to any post office. You can get the forms at any post office or download them here.

Step 2:

After your documents get approved, go to the closest ID capture station. You can find the full list on the WHERE TO APPLY page. At these stations in post offices and some malls, they’ll take your photo and fingerprints. There are about 260 stations all over the country.

Step 3:

After you finish capturing your ID details, we’ll send your ID to your address.

In Metro Manila, it takes about 10 to 15 working days.

For islands and remote areas, it may take around 4 to 5 weeks.

Application Requirements For Postal ID

Get the original and a photocopy of these documents:

I. Fill out two (2) PID application forms completely.
II. Show proof of identity with any of these:

  • Birth Certificate from NSO or Local Civil Registry
  • GSIS or SSS UMID Card
  • Valid Driver’s License
  • Valid Passport
  • Marriage Contract for married women (if submitted documents don’t have the married name).

If you don’t have a Birth Certificate, UMID Card, Driver’s License, or Passport, you can provide ANY TWO (2) of these documents. At least one should have your photo and signature:

  • BIR ID
  • Baptismal Certificate
  • Certificate of Birth
  • College or Post-Graduate Transcript of Records
  • Confirmation Certificate
  • Elementary or High School Form 137
  • Marriage Certificate
  • Valid Alumni ID
  • Valid Basic Postal ID
  • Valid College, School, or University ID
  • Valid Company ID
  • Valid Integrated Bar of the Philippines (IBP) ID
  • Valid NBI Clearance
  • Valid OWWA ID
  • Valid Pag-Ibig ID
  • Valid PhilHealth ID
  • Valid PRC ID
  • Valid Paper-based Postal ID
  • Valid Police Clearance
  • Valid Seaman’s Book
  • Valid Senior Citizen ID
  • Valid Tax Identification Number Card
  • Valid Voter’s ID

To prove your address, provide one of the following:

  1. Barangay Certificate of Residency (last 3 months)
  2. Certified True Copy of Lease
  3. Certified True Copy of Titles from LRA
  4. Certified True Copy of Real Estate Tax Receipt
  5. Bank Statement.
  6. Credit Card Statement.
  7. School Billing Statement.
  8. Utility Bill (cable, electric, internet, landline, telephone, water).

Requirements for Foreign Residents Applying:

  • Fill out two (2) application forms.
  • Provide Proof of Identity: a. Valid Passport (min. 6 months before application) b. Pick one option from the list, valid for six months:
  • Alien Certificate of Registration Identity Card (ACRI-Card)
  • Long Stay Visitor Visa Extension (LSVVE)
  • Temporary Resident Visa (TRV)
  • Diplomatic Visa
  • Special Resident Retiree’s Visa (SRRV)

Prove your address with any of the following documents:

1. Barangay Certificate of Residency issued within 3 months of PID application.

2. Certification or statement of account from hotels, transient homes, or temporary residences within 3 months before application.

3. Certification from hotels, transient homes, or temporary residences within 3 months before application.

4. Notarized Land, House, or Condominium Lease Contract, if applicable.

5. Bank statement.

6. Credit card statement.

7. School billing statement.

8. Utility bills (cable, electric, internet, landline, telephone, water).
